Job Report<br />

Drinking <strong>water</strong> pipe<strong>line</strong> for Services Industriels de<br />

Genève in <strong>Geneva</strong>, Switzerland<br />

Client:<br />

Services Industriels de Genève, <strong>Geneva</strong> and KFS Service de Canalisation SA, Payerne<br />

Year of construction:<br />

2013<br />

Type of construction measure:<br />

Renewal of a DN 500 drinking <strong>water</strong> pipe<strong>line</strong> in Cologny in Switzerland, along Lake <strong>Geneva</strong><br />

Our services:<br />

• Delivery of a flexible high-pressure pipe<strong>line</strong> Primus Line ® and the Primus Line connector<br />

• Installation of the Primus Line ® system<br />

Situation:<br />

The pipe<strong>line</strong> DN 500 to be renewed lies in the municipality of Cologny, which is connected with <strong>Geneva</strong>. The<br />

pipe<strong>line</strong> is laid along Lake <strong>Geneva</strong>, and lies parallel to the Quai de Cologny road in <strong>Geneva</strong> or Cologny in the<br />

grass verge along the promenade. The pipe<strong>line</strong> sections to be renewed were determined by the client as l = 32<br />

+ 238 + 25 + 245 + 245 + 260 + 20 + 120 + 320 and 210 m. The aim of the measure was to execute construction<br />

work whilst intervening as little as possible with the promenade and the tree population. The aim was also<br />

to connect the DN 500 pipe<strong>line</strong> to the network again after the shortest possible construction period. Due to these<br />

requirements, Services Industriels de Genève decided on space-saving and fast pipe<strong>line</strong> renewal using the<br />

Primus Line ® system. In accordance with the order, Primus Line ® had to permit an operating pressure of 16 bar<br />

in the drinking <strong>water</strong> pipe<strong>line</strong>. In order to guarantee this operating pressure, a single layer<br />

Primus Line DN 500 high-pressure hose was pulled into all pipe<strong>line</strong> sections.


Technical Details:<br />

Host Pipe Material:<br />

Pipe made of glass fibre reinforced plastic, inner diameter = 500 mm,<br />

outside diameter = 530 mm<br />

Transported Medium:<br />

Drinking <strong>water</strong><br />

Host Pipe Diameter: DN 500<br />

Operating Pressure:<br />

PN 16 bar<br />

Primus Line ® System:<br />

Flexible high-pressure pipe<strong>line</strong> DN 500 PN 16 bar (single layer)<br />

Total Length:<br />

1,715 m<br />

Number of Construction Sections: 10 installation sections with l = 32 + 238 + 25 + 245 + 245 + 260 +<br />

20 + 120 + 320 and 210 m<br />

Installation Time:<br />

Installation of the Primus Line ® system in a total of 10 working days<br />

Rehabilitation System:<br />

Services Industriels de Genève, <strong>Geneva</strong> (Switzerland) decided on the installation of the<br />

Primus Line ® system by Rädlinger. Primus Line ® is a flexible high-pressure pipe<strong>line</strong> which is coated with plastics,<br />

and can be manufactured at Primus Line‘s own plant to seamless lengths of up to 4500 m. The available<br />

test certificates according to the DVGW W270 (German Technical and Scientific Association for Gas and Water)<br />

and the KTW (Plastics in Potable Water) regulations also permit application of the system for the renewal<br />

of drinking <strong>water</strong> pipe<strong>line</strong>s.<br />

The Primus Line DN 500 high-pressure hose for drinking <strong>water</strong> with a single layer construction, which is<br />

installed in the pipe<strong>line</strong>, is able to withstand pipe<strong>line</strong> operating pressures of up to 16 bar.<br />

<strong>Project</strong> Description:<br />

The DN 500 pipe<strong>line</strong> was blocked off and disconnected from the drinking <strong>water</strong> network. In preparation for the<br />

pipe<strong>line</strong> renewal, construction pits were created by KFS Service de Canalisation, the DN 500 pipes and fittings<br />

were removed from the pits and the entire pipe<strong>line</strong> was subjected to a TV inspection. Existing incrustations and<br />

deposits in the host pipe were removed with <strong>water</strong> by KFS Service de Canalisation using ultra-high pressure<br />

cleaning equipment. The Primus Line DN 500 PN 16 hose was prefolded at the company headquarters in<br />

Cham, and coiled in accordance with the individual renewal sections onto drums of l = 2.40 m and l = 4.00 m,<br />

delivered on trucks to the construction site and pulled into the existing DN 50 pipe.<br />

Due to the folding technology used and the related reduction of insertion forces for Primus Line ® , the DN 500<br />

hoses could be pulled into the renewal sections from l = 20 m to l = 320 m with a maximum tensile force of<br />

17 kN. The permitted insertion forces for the Primus Line DN 500 high-pressure hose total 100 kN.<br />

After assembly of the Primus Line connector and the installation of the adapter pieces in the construction<br />

pits, the renewed pipe<strong>line</strong> area was subjected to a leak test supervised by KFS in accordance with the Swiss<br />

standards.<br />

Renewal of the pipe<strong>line</strong> was successfully completed with the disinfection, a flushing procedure and then the<br />

connection of the Primus Line ® pipe<strong>line</strong> to the existing network.<br />

Due to the selected form of renewal, it was possible to restore the supply security with drinking <strong>water</strong> within a<br />

very short construction period and without major interventions to the promenade.<br />
